NeighbourhoodThis detached home on Broekstraat sits in the rural outskirts of Nederasselt, surrounded by open fields and greenery. With 393 m² of living space on a generous 13,000 m² plot, it offers plenty of room for a large family or anyone who values space and privacy. The price of €1,275,000 is on the high side compared to other detached houses in Heumen, but the exceptional plot size and energy label B make it a distinctive offering.
The neighbourhood Verspreide huizen Nederasseltse Uiterwaarden is a tiny hamlet with only 55 residents, mostly families and couples. It is a very rural area, with the lowest urbanity score (5 out of 5). There are no neighbourhood reviews available, so the picture comes from the statistics: most homes are owner-occupied, and the area is very quiet with few facilities nearby.
For your daily shopping, the nearest supermarket is Albert Heijn, about a ten-minute walk away, with Nettorama and Jumbo also within a couple of streets away. The closest primary school is De Tandem, just under a kilometre away, while Basisschool Hartenaas and De Sprankel are a bit further. The nearest train station is 6.6 km away, so a car is essential for commuting. The municipality Heumen offers a mix of rural and small-town living.
